As a manufacturer, you need to keep costs down, so using the same part across your entire range of motorcycles makes huge commercial sense – rather than four different mudguards, why not one and fit it to four different models? While you’re at it, perhaps with internal mods and a different cylinder head, the same 500cc bottom end can power the commuter, sports and even TT models.
